Title

Atmospheric DBD Plasma Improves Agronomic Traits in Brassica Juncea

Abstract

This study investigates the effects of atmospheric-pressure dielectric barrier discharge(DBD) Plasma treatment on the agronomic performance of Brassica juncea (L.) Czern.(Brown mustard). Seeds were exposed to DBD plasma for varying durations and subsequently evaluated for germination, kinetics, seedling growth, parameters, disease registance etc. Results demonstrated that plasma treatment enhanced germination rates upto 25% compared to untreated controls with concomitant improvements in radicle elongation and seedling vigor. Treated plants exhibited increased registance to Alternari brassicae infection, corrlated with elevated activity of defense related enzymes(peroxidase, phenylalanine ammonia-lyase). Field trials revealed a 15-20% increase in harvestable yield for plasma treated cohorts. Spectroscopic analysis confirmed the generation of reactive nitrogen species during treatment ,suggesting their role in eliciting plant defense mechanisms. Notably DBD plasma application effectively reduced seed-borne pathogen load without chemical fungicides , indicating its potential as a sustainable pre-sowing treatment. These findings establish DBD plasma as a viable physical seed enhancement technology for improving productivity and disease management in B. juncea cultivation.
